Transaction e3253764d7bb736174adff57b95102e8228fe052a372038ec82eebf69cae1679
3 Input
2 Outputs
- e3253764d7bb736174adff57b95102e8228fe052a372038ec82eebf69cae1679:0
- e3253764d7bb736174adff57b95102e8228fe052a372038ec82eebf69cae1679:1
value 9218200
address 16nCXbw94Vaw7asEM9TAg6NKtwkrzQXwMq
value 70000000
address 19fJRMiWgcCMLgYfNBYuhMyqqxyiUTiw5D